WebContractors usually follow a guideline of around 20 square feet (2 square meters) of collector area for each of the first two family members. For every additional person, add 8 square feet (0.7 square meters) if you live in the U.S. Sun Belt area or 12–14 square feet if you live in the northern United States. WebA.O. Smith. Are more expensive than electric water heaters. ear protector hs codeWebApr 23, 2024 · Step 1. Gas water heaters need proper venting for operation. To check the venting on your existing unit, close all windows and doors and turn on all gas appliances and exhaust fans and turn up the temperature on your water heater for a few minutes. Then, hold an extinguished match near the vent hood. The smoke should pull into the hood. ear protection snoringWebThe flow rate through the demand water heater should be at least 3.25 gallons (12.3 liters) per minute.
